It is wise to supply the tenant with an itemized list of the things comprised in the flat rental when renting a furnished apartment to protect your investment. Be very specific; list the number of plates, bowls, and cups, for example, and describe things as accurately as possible. List the replacement cost of each thing if it is damaged beyond normal wear and tear, or if the piece is taken by the tenant with him when he moves out. Signal if the replacement cost will be taken out of the security deposit, or if the tenant will have to pay you for the things. Have the tenant sign a copy of this inventory so there are not any surprises when the lease comes to a conclusion.

Whether you own a vacation rental or want to hire one, it is important to shield yourself with a contract that clearly lays out the responsibilities and obligations of all parties.

Times and the dates of departure and arrival are spelled out in great specificity in the vacation rental lease. Vacationers are coming and going every week--sometimes every few days--and the units must be cleaned between stays. To avoid vacancy between stays, the time between check-in and checkout is normally a comparatively short window. And because some vacationers rely on air transportation, there are occasionally last minute requests to arrive or depart late or early. It is, therefore, important to include eventuality requests in the lease, indicating both a price and a procedure to alter agreed upon plans.
